import { Node, Program } from "./types/ast";
import { ContentRenderer } from "./renderer/ContentRenderer";
import { MustacheRenderer } from "./renderer/MustacheRenderer";
import { ProgramRenderer } from "./renderer/ProgramRenderer";
import { HelperFn } from "./types/helper";
import { NodeMapping, RenderContext } from "./types/nodeMapping";
import { PathEvaluator } from "./expressions/PathEvaluator";
import { LiteralEvaluator } from "./expressions/LiteralEvaluator";
import { SubExpressionEvaluator } from "./expressions/SubExpressionEvaluator";
type Runnable = (input: Record<string, unknown>) => string;
export class HandlebarsNgRunner {
helpers: Map<string, HelperFn> = new Map();
compile(ast: Program): Runnable {
const renderer = nodeMapping.createRenderer(ast);
return (input) => {
const context: RenderContext = {
input,
output: "",
helpers: this.helpers,
};
renderer.render(context);
return context.output;
};
}
registerHelper(name: string, fn: HelperFn) {
this.helpers.set(name, fn);
}
}
const nodeMapping: NodeMapping = {
createEvaluator(node) {
switch (node.type) {
case "PathExpression":
return new PathEvaluator(node);
case "StringLiteral":
case "NumberLiteral":
case "BooleanLiteral":
return new LiteralEvaluator(node);
case "SubExpression":
return new SubExpressionEvaluator(node, nodeMapping);
default:
unexpectedNodeType(node);
}
},
createRenderer(node) {
switch (node.type) {
case "ContentStatement":
return new ContentRenderer(node);
case "MustacheStatement":
return new MustacheRenderer(node, this);
case "Program":
return new ProgramRenderer(node, this);
case "CommentStatement":
throw new Error("Not yet implemented");
default:
unexpectedNodeType(node);
}
},
};
function unexpectedNodeType(node: never): never {
throw new Error("Unexpected node type" + (node as Node).type);
}
